设为首页 加入收藏

TOP

数据库操作错误信息解决
2014-11-24 03:31:01 来源: 作者: 【 】 浏览:3
Tags:数据库 操作 错误 信息 解决

数据库操作错误信息解决
Sql代码
1.写插入语句 insert into 时出现如下错误:
“仅当使用了列列表并且 IDENTITY_INSERT 为 ON 时,才能为表'tBarcodeImport'中的标识列指定显式值。” www.2cto.com
“当 IDENTITY_INSERT 设置为 OFF 时,不能为表 'tBarcodeImport' 中的标识列插入显式值。”
(1).出错原因:表tBarcodeImport的标识列(即主键id列)为自增长列,默认情况下不能进行赋值
(2).解决方案:
A.sql 语句不对id进行处理,例如 insert into tBarcodeImport (此处不包含id,.....) values(......)
B.设置 对标识列 IDENTITY_INSERT 的开关为允许
SET IDENTITY_INSERT tBarcodeImport ON // 打开
SET IDENTITY_INSERT tBarcodeImport OFF //关闭
注:此方式的 insert 语句必须 显示写出插入字段
】【打印繁体】【投稿】【收藏】 【推荐】【举报】【评论】 【关闭】 【返回顶部
分享到: 
上一篇【bdump】bdump目录下产生大量cdm.. 下一篇查历史统计信息的语句

评论

帐  号: 密码: (新用户注册)
验 证 码:
表  情:
内  容:

·数据库:推荐几款 Re (2025-12-25 12:17:11)
·如何最简单、通俗地 (2025-12-25 12:17:09)
·什么是Redis?为什么 (2025-12-25 12:17:06)
·对于一个想入坑Linux (2025-12-25 11:49:07)
·Linux 怎么读? (2025-12-25 11:49:04)